PJ2's reference to IR3, (p72 - 76) made me read those pages again. I was puzzled by the following reference to the FPV, since the trace on page 107 shows that HDG-VS selected all the time (my bolding):
At around 2 h 11 min 42, the Captain came back into the cockpit, (...) Neither of the two copilots gave him a precise summary of the problems encountered nor of the actions undertaken, except that they had lost control of the airplane and that they had tried everything. In reaction, the Captain said several times “take that”, doubtless speaking of the FPV. (...)
There also seems to be a translation error further down on the same page, where "nose-up" should read "nose-down" (à piquer in the french original):
Several nose-up inputs caused a decrease in the pitch attitude and in the angle of attack whose values then became valid, so that a strong nose-down input led to the reactivation of the stall warning.
Plusieurs actions à piquer provoquent une diminution de l’assiette et de l’incidence ...
